Buckeye ​Hot Springs – California

Nestled in the great Sierras, Buckeye Hot Springs is one of the great rustic primitive natural pools in the state. Located in Bridgeport (home to a few other hot springs as well), this is the perfect paradise to get away from the world for a few hours and relax in mother nature. There are two different hot springs areas for you to enjoy. Many tend to flock towards Buckeye Creek where the hot springs waters cascade down over you at 112 degrees. There is even a small cave area under the small waterfall where you can hide for a little while and soak by yourself. The other other springs is made from rocks and has some unbelievable views of California’s Sierras. Whichever you choose, Buckeye Hot Springs is a true attraction that you need to visit when traveling in the state.

We should mention clothing is optional so be prepared to see some naked people if you go in the early morning or late evening.

Directions to Buckeye Hot Springs

1. From Bridgeport go west on highway 395
2. Make a left onto Twin Lakes Road
3. Continue for 4 miles and make a right onto Buckeye Rd.
4. Continue 3 miles and you will hit a dirt road that will lead you to the parking area.
